About Upper Mount Gravatt 4122

The size of Upper Mount Gravatt is approximately 4.3 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 5.9% of total area. The population of Upper Mount Gravatt in 2016 was 9241 people. By 2021 the population was 10800 showing a population growth of 16.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Upper Mount Gravatt is 20-29 years. Households in Upper Mount Gravatt are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Upper Mount Gravatt work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 51.40% of the homes in Upper Mount Gravatt were owner-occupied compared with 56.20% in 2016.

Upper Mount Gravatt has 5,559 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Upper Mount Gravatt have seen a 98.84%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 81.03%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Upper Mount Gravatt is $1,278,475 while the median value for Units is $713,615.
  • Houses have a median rent of $675 while Units have a median rent of $660.
